Fundraiser in Walker Dec. 2

Enjoy a soup/chili fundraiser, craft and bake sale from 10 a.m. until 3 p.m. in the Walker Community Building Saturday, Dec. 2. Soup/chili dessert and drink – $5, under 5 eats free. There will also be a raffle for a cross quilt – tickets $1 or 6 for $5. Sponsored by the Walker Faith Baptists
